Puerto Vallarta experienced a significant boost in tourism this week as two cruise ships made a simultaneous visit, bringing over 11,000 passengers to the city.
The Navigator of the Seas and the Carnival Firenze arrived on Tuesday, October 1st, with a combined total of 10,903 passengers and crew members. According to the National Port System Administration (Asipona Vallarta), this marks the first double arrival of cruise ships in Puerto Vallarta for the season.
A few hours earlier, the Carnival Firenze, measuring 323 meters in length, arrived with 5,869 passengers and crew. With an estimated average spending of $120 per person, the double arrival is expected to generate over $1.3 million in economic activity for the city.
Puerto Vallarta is anticipating a busy cruise season this year, with 16 scheduled arrivals in October alone, including eight double arrivals and one overnight stay.
